Product Description:

The HCS01.1E-W0028-A-03-B-ET-EC-NN-NN-NN-AW is an HCS drive controller manufactured by Bosch Rexroth Indramat for the HCS IndraDrive Controllers series. It converts three-phase mains power into a regulated DC link and a pulse-width-modulated output, enabling precise speed, position, and torque control of servo or induction motors in industrial automation cells. This controller is intended for cabinet-mounted drive systems where compact size, network communication, and closed-loop motor control are required. It is used as the power and control stage for applications that need accurate axis response and stable motor regulation.

This controller communicates with higher-level PLCs through the MultiEthernet interface, so one physical port can exchange real-time data across several Ethernet-based fieldbuses. It accepts a supply of 3 x AC 200 to 500 V ±10%, and during acceleration or braking, the inverter stage can deliver up to 28 A of peak current to the motor windings. Protection is provided by an IP20 enclosure, which is suitable for installation inside a control cabinet. Cooling relies on internal air cooling driven by an integrated blower to maintain component temperature without external ducting. The HCS01 line code indicates the frame size used for this power class, and the unit is design version 1.

The drive section is paired with a control section identified as BASIC, which provides standard motion functions but does not include advanced technology packages or safety features. The feedback connection uses an IndraDyn Hiperface/EnDat 2.1/2.2 encoder interface, allowing precise position data to enter the control loop for demanding motion profiles. The DC link is arranged for infeeding and fed operation, so regenerated energy can return to the shared bus or the mains during deceleration. A second feedback slot is present, but Interface 2 is not equipped, leaving that position open. No supplementary design features are installed, so normal operation depends on adequate cabinet airflow and properly shielded motor and feedback cables.

Communication Interface
MultiEthernet
Control Section Design Type
BASIC
Cooling Method
Air, internal (through integrated blower)
Design Version
1
Device Peak Current
28 A
Interface 1 Type
Encoder IndraDyn Hiperface/EnDat 2.1/2.2
Interface 2 Type
Not equipped
IP Rating
IP20
Line Series
HCS01
Mains Voltage
3 x AC 200...500 V ±10%
Other Design Features
None
Pairing Note
Paired with Control Section Design 'BASIC' (B)
Power Supply Unit
Infeeding / Feeded
Product Type
HCS Drive Controller
Safety Interface
Not equipped
